    Hi all,

    I have a Gigabyte GA-EX58-UD3R Mobo and got the Dominator 6GB (3x2GB) DDR3 Memory (TR3X6G1600C8D). My motherboard has 4 slots and I would like to fill the last one really, but I don't seem to be able to find anywhere that will sell this memory card on its own.

    Does anyone know where I can get one, if it is even possible, or have any other ideas as to be able to use the last memory slot please?

    Just leave it as 6gb mate, if you stick to just using the white slots it will all run in tri channel, I dont know why they added the 4th slot but I dot think you would get that much of a boost filling it.
